Cleaning or replacing your gutters might seem like a simple DIY task—but it’s far from risk-free. Every year, thousands of Canadians are injured in falls from ladders, roofs, and other elevated surfaces. In fact, falls from heights remain one of the leading causes of fatalities in the construction industry, according to multiple safety boards across the country such as the Infrastructure Health & Safety Association (IHSA)
In Ottawa, our tough climate adds another layer of danger. Snow, ice, and freezing rain can make even the most stable ladder slippery. That’s why winter gutter prep is not just about function—it’s about safety. Properly installed and maintained eavestroughs protect your home from ice dams and water damage, but doing the work without the right training or gear can put your life at risk.

Common Risks of DIY Gutter Work
While it may be tempting to grab a ladder and tackle gutter issues yourself, DIY gutter work comes with serious hazards:
-
Ladder falls: A major cause of home injury claims. A slip or misstep can lead to fractures, head trauma, or worse.
-
Falling debris: Unsecured tools or gutter components can injure you or damage property.
-
Electrocution risks: Working near overhead power lines or using conductive materials like metal tools can lead to electrical accidents.The Electrical Safety Authority (ESA) of Ontario provides crucial information on staying safe around power lines.
According to the Ontario Ministry of Labour, any work at heights of 3 metres (10 feet) or more requires proper fall protection. Ignoring these guidelines can result in injury, legal trouble, or both.

Working at Heights Legislation
Under Ontario Regulation O. Reg. 297/13, anyone working at heights on construction projects must complete approved Working at Heights training. You can learn more about these mandatory training requirements on the official Ontario government website. Failure to comply can result in fines, liability, and site shutdowns. These laws exist for a reason—because proper training saves lives.

Preventing Ice Dams and Storm Damage
Improperly installed gutters don’t just pose safety risks—they can lead to expensive property damage. Ice dams form when water backs up due to poor drainage or slope, seeping under shingles and into your home.
Proper installation by trained professionals ensures:

-
Correct slope for drainage
-
Durable, weather-resistant materials
-
Fewer clogs and blockages during heavy rain or snow
Home insurance providers often cite poor roof drainage as a major factor in winter water damage claims.The Insurance Bureau of Canada (IBC) offers insights into preventing water damage to your home. Protecting your home starts with a gutter system that’s installed right the first time.
